Question: Correct power rating of bulb used in our country (India):

  • a) 100 volt
  • b) 100 volt
  • c) 100 W - 220 volt
  • d) 10 volt

Answer: 100 W - 220 volt


Question: Number of Joules in kWh is :

  • a) 3.6 × 107 
  • b) 3.6 × 106 
  • c) 3.6 × 105 
  • d) 3.6 × 104

Answer: 3.6 × 106 

 

Question: An electric iron of heating element of resistance 88 Ω is used at 220 volt for 2 hours. The electric energy spent, in unit, will be :

  • a) 0.8
  • b) 1.1
  • c) 2.2
  • d) 8.8

Answer: 1.1


Question: Two identical heater wires are first connected in series and then in parallel with a source of electricity. The ratio of heat produced in the two cases is :

  • a) 2 : 1
  • b) 1 : 2
  • c) 4 : 1
  • d) 1 : 4

Answer: 1 : 4


Question: You are given three bulbs 25 W, 40 W and 60 W. Which of them has the lowest resistance ?

  • a) 25 watt bulb
  • b) 40 watt bulb
  • c) 60 watt bulb
  • d) Insufficient data

Answer: 60 watt bulb


Question: An electric heater can boil a certain amount of water in 10 minute and another heater can do it in 15 minute, both working at the same voltage. If the two heaters are connected in parallel across the same voltage as before how much time will they take to boil the same amount of water ?

  • a) 9 min
  • b) 12.5 min
  • c) 7.5 min
  • d) 6 min

Answer: 6 min
